Transaction 6740a55db0c2ce98c539863d6b0dc5db280e1eb24f07dd1cef701c1f28876e85

105 Input
2 Outputs
  • 6740a55db0c2ce98c539863d6b0dc5db280e1eb24f07dd1cef701c1f28876e85:0
  • value  1192057529
    address  3PWa1S9ZCLWYsDLHM1gtEJ9Rn1FVjq5GhG
  • 6740a55db0c2ce98c539863d6b0dc5db280e1eb24f07dd1cef701c1f28876e85:1
  • value  1017517
    address  3CTBFQgEyW7fR1UsDL8abhEZ8oyiq5eHZT